Aldi is taking good care of its gluten-free donut fans

"Gluten free donuts!!!" proclaims Adventures in Aldi on Instagram, along with a photo of three boxes of Live G Free brand's frozen gluten-free holiday donuts, which come in cranberry, gingerbread, and pumpkin flavors. The post also includes the most important information of all: "You can find these bad boys in the Aldi finds freezer section right now," Adventures in Aldi clarifies for its 72.6 thousand followers.
